Gold rhinestones are used for embellishing a multitude of things, such as dance, theatre and other performance costumes, clothing, shoes and accessories, crafts, greetings cards, home furnishings, bridalwear, fingernails, phone cases, picture frames, make up brushes and much more!

Gold rhinestones can be applied to fabric using the hotfix or non hotfix method, i.e. heated on with an iron, or glued on. Larger gold sew on rhinestones can be sewn on as well as glued.

Yes, gold rhinestones are very popular for using on nails, many nail artists choose gold to give a luxurious feel. They need to be applied using a nail glue and curing under a lamp.

Yes, gold rhinestones such as Honey, Gold Quartz, Golden Shadow and Rose Gold are very popular colours, so are available from size ss5 (1.8mm) up to SS40 (8.5mm). They are also available in larger sew on shapes.
